最新章節
書友吧第1章 2000年
邵毅猛地睜開眼。
我是誰?我在哪?我不是應該在公司嗎?我不是在寫代碼嗎?
“哇!好沖!”周圍傳來一股泡面味。
“這是...大屁股BRT顯示器?”
“Windoes XP?都停止支持了多少年,為什么還有海報?”
等等,我不會穿越了吧?
看向屏幕右下角,2004年10月21日。
邵毅的手點開開始菜單,確定了這就是Windoes XP系統。
“好久沒有看見了,玩會三維彈球吧。”
就在邵毅沉迷于三維彈球時,他的眼前出現一個XP樣式的提示框。
“哎呀煩死了!叉掉叉掉!”
邵毅看不到自己的光標。
“哎,我的鼠標呢!不會圖層在這個提示框之下吧。”
邵毅看向鼠標時,驚奇的發現提示框還在眼前。
“好像是我眼睛里的東西,先看看什么內容。”
[游戲平臺核心系統-安裝向導]
歡迎使用!正在完成安裝... 100%
綁定用戶:邵毅(主角名)
終極目標:在.COM Framework 1.0(應用運行框架)的世界里,建立下一代數字游戲樞紐。(吐槽時代)
初始模塊解鎖:
[基礎框架藍圖]:提供基于XP系統服務的平臺架構思路(用戶賬戶、自動更新、簡易商店)。
[技術預見(Lv.0)]:可模糊感知“DirectC 8.1”(渲染引擎)級別技術的潛力(冷卻中)。
[代碼優化(Lv.0)]:小幅提升宿主編寫的B#/.COM 1.0(代碼語言)代碼效率(日限1次)。
系統狀態:運行于 Windows XP專業版
系統能量:0/100 (通過平臺開發進度、用戶增長獲取)
“哎?這個是...系統!豁,沒想到在我身上出現了當代小說下的金手指!”
“這個系統的意思是...Steam?專業對口嗎這不是!”
讓我想想看有哪些痛點。
(拍桌)“老板,你這沒有狂獸爭霸3的更新補丁光盤啊!順便,你這能買點卡嗎?”
對啊!現代游戲最重要的就是更新!我得拿本本記下來。還有在線支付的問題,但這時候沒有支付寶和微信啊。
而且這時候網絡速度慢,費用貴,上網沖浪非常奢侈,也得解決。
“新手任務:利用XP特性,打造游戲更新器。獎勵:[技術預見 Lv 0.5]”
好,那么開始著手做吧。
如果我沒記錯的話,XP有傳輸服務系統,這時候也有P2P(點對點連接),完全可以做一個在后臺的更新器。
“系統,給我框架藍圖,并安裝Visual Work .COM 2003(集成開發環境)到電腦上。”
他選擇用B#,這個他最熟悉的編程語言做。
寫到一半,他發現P2P端口在XP防火墻下的穿透有問題,于是他直接使用代碼優化功能,系統給他的代碼修正了一段處理防火墻規則的試探性代碼,增加了對XP自帶防火墻的兼容性注釋。
.COM 1.0還是太弱了,但這系統好啊!
經過了3個小時的奮力開發和優化后,游戲更新器“SPUpdateService.exe”終于開發好了。
這個東西的核心功能:
以Windoes服務形式安裝,開機靜默運行于后臺。
利用增量差分技術,只下載更新變化的部分。
如果局域網內有更新的游戲,那么會嘗試局域網內P2P共享下載源,減輕服務器壓力,同時避免高昂網費。
并且還通過簡單的系統托盤圖標提示更新進度。
邵毅開始嘗試例:奔揚1.7G + 256MB DDR的XP電腦上,模擬更新一個5MB的游戲補丁。傳統方式(HTTP下載)耗時10分鐘,他的 SPUpdateService結合P2P,只用了2分鐘!并且進度條正確顯示,后臺服務運行平穩。
他看著系統托盤里那個簡陋的蒸汽齒輪圖標,長舒一口氣:“有了這個基于XP服務的更新核心,Steam才算真正扎根在這個時代!”
系統提示:“新手任務完成!獎勵:[技術預見(Lv.0.5)]系統能量+15。請尋找首位合作開發者,并為其游戲集成‘SPUpdateService’。”
邵毅問:“技術預見0.5有什么?”
“解鎖預見模式:“潛力掃描”(被動)+“關鍵節點提示”(主動/冷卻)”。
“嗯...找開發者啊,登錄三大媽論壇看看吧。”
登錄三大媽游戲論壇的“獨立團隊”板塊下,一則加粗標紅的帖子瞬間抓住他眼球:
標題:《【星火工作室】跪求大佬!《刀劍Online》單機試玩版v0.3更新后啟動崩潰,XP下崩潰率100%!急招高手救火!》
發帖人:張工(星火工作室主程)
內容亮點:
“自研引擎,武俠開放世界雛形!截圖展示:無縫大地圖輕功展示、簡易的武器鍛造界面。”
“更新器問題:我們自制的更新器在XP下安裝新補丁后,游戲主程序崩潰率100%,Win98下反而正常!Debug三天無果,快瘋了!”
“有償求助!現金或分成談!QQ:1218858474驗證:刀劍。”
“臥槽!這無縫和鍛造系統,不是后來網游的核心賣點嗎?!這也是穿越的吧!”
當邵毅目光聚焦在帖子標題和發帖人“張工”上時,視野中帖子標題旁猛地爆發出一股洶涌的亮藍色能量流,如噴泉般急速攀升!
能量條瞬間突破 80%!并且核心區域閃爍著醒目的碎金光芒,仿佛有龍在其中游動!
“亮藍!80%+!還有金龍特效?!這…這項目潛力巨大!張工是關鍵人物!系統在瘋狂提示我:必須拿下他們!”
邵毅心臟狂跳,毫不猶豫地消耗10點能量,主動對游戲:“解決《刀劍Online》XP崩潰問題并達成合作”使用了關鍵節點提示!
系統界面劇烈波動,一行扭曲的、仿佛由劍氣和代碼組成的提示炸開:
“死鎖:GDI+ Handle Leak (0x58)。鑰匙:Hook LoadImage。”
提示一閃即逝,關鍵節點提示進入48小時冷卻。
“渲染句柄泄漏?!XP下經典的資源泄露問題!是了!他們的自制更新器肯定用了非標準方式加載資源圖片,沒釋放干凈!Win98可以,XP直接鎖死!這提示…太精準了!”
邵毅深吸一口氣,眼神銳利如刀。他迅速點開發帖人的QQ,驗證信息“刀劍更新器XP崩潰解決方案”。
在好友請求通過的第一時間,他直接發送了一段殺氣騰騰的信息:
“張工,我是陸遠。你游戲在XP下100%崩潰的問題,根源在GDI+句柄泄漏,錯誤碼核心是0x58。
你們自研引擎的資源加載模塊,特別是更新器在打補丁時非標準調用 LoadImage且未配套釋放,導致XP內核耗盡句柄。
解決方案:用鉤子攔截并規范 LoadImage調用鏈,確保每次加載都有配對釋放。我有現成的Hook方案和內存泄漏檢測工具,針對XP優化過。
給我一個遠程桌面權限和崩潰現場,2小時內給你穩定版本。若解決,報酬我不要現金,我要《刀劍Online》成為我蒸汽平臺的首發獨占游戲,并深度集成我的SPUpdateService。合作,還是看著項目死?你只有5分鐘考慮。”